About Southfield Elementary School

Southfield Elementary School is a public elementary school in Macon, GA, part of Bibb County. Southfield Elementary School serves approximately 688 students, and covers grades Pre-K-5th, and has a 14:1 student-teacher ratio. Southfield Elementary School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 6.0 out of 10 and ranks #1,268 of 2,268 schools in GA.

Structured state assessment records for Southfield Elementary School show 8%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2015-2024) and 9%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2015-2024).

What Parents Should Know

Test scores at Southfield Elementary School sit below average, but its growth scores are strong: students here make above-average progress year over year. The raw numbers haven't caught up, but a school that keeps moving kids forward is doing the harder, more important work.

Southfield Elementary School sits in a rural area, which can mean longer drives for some families. Rural schools are often community anchors with smaller classes, but check transportation, after-school options, and access to specialized services before you commit.

54% of students at Southfield Elementary School were chronically absent in the 2022-23 school year, above the national average. Chronic absenteeism means missing 15 or more school days, and at high rates it drags on classroom pacing for everyone. Ask what the school does to help families get kids to class consistently.
